The Role
As Temporary Works Coordinator, you will be responsible for coordinating and managing temporary works activities across the project, ensuring designs, installations and associated documentation comply with project procedures, relevant legislation and BS 5975:2019.
You will act as a key interface between engineering, design and construction teams, ensuring temporary works are properly planned, checked, approved, installed and maintained throughout the project lifecycle.
Key Responsibilities
Maintain and regularly update the Temporary Works Register / Schedule
Coordinate temporary works requirements between design, engineering and construction teams
Prepare and review temporary works design briefs before issue to designers
Ensure temporary works designs comply with the approved design brief
Coordinate design reviews, checks, approvals and associated documentation
Manage temporary works design progress against the construction programme
Ensure sufficient time is allowed for design, checking, approval and installation
Manage temporary works design changes and revisions
Ensure relevant design check and approval documentation is completed
Provide technical guidance to project and construction teams
Support the management of temporary works risks during pre-construction and delivery
Review method statements, work package plans and construction activities relating to temporary works
Carry out inspections of temporary works installations
Ensure installations comply with approved designs before loading or use
Establish and manage inspection and hold points
Produce and review Inspection Test Plans (ITPs) and Quality Check Sheets
Monitor temporary works installations and ensure they are correctly maintained
Coordinate with subcontractor Temporary Works Coordinators and Supervisors
Liaise with client representatives and other project stakeholders
Support the assessment and ongoing competence of Temporary Works Supervisors
Ensure temporary works activities comply with project procedures, safety requirements and applicable standards
